About Amitava Ray

Amitava Ray is a scholar working on Mechanical Engineering, Electrical and Electronic Engineering, Management Science and Operations Research, Strategy and Management and Materials Chemistry, having authored 115 papers that have together received 2.0k indexed citations. Recurring topics across this work include Sustainable Supply Chain Management (20 papers), Multi-Criteria Decision Making (18 papers), Advanced machining processes and optimization (16 papers), Metal Alloys Wear and Properties (16 papers), Advanced Machining and Optimization Techniques (15 papers), Quality Function Deployment in Product Design (11 papers), Microstructure and Mechanical Properties of Steels (11 papers) and Metallurgy and Material Forming (10 papers). The work is most often cited by research in Strategy and Management (505 citations), Management Science and Operations Research (408 citations), Metals and Alloys (54 citations), Management Information Systems (185 citations) and Ecological Modeling (80 citations). Amitava Ray has collaborated with scholars based in India, Switzerland and United States. Frequent co-authors include Jagadish Jagadish, Sumit Bhowmik, Chiranjib Bhowmik, S. K. Dhua, Anupam Haldar, Madhab Chandra Mandal, Debamalya Banerjee, Krishna Murari Pandey, D. S. Sarma and Subir K. Sanyal. Their work appears in journals such as International Journal of Management Science and Engineering Management, Journal of Materials Engineering and Performance, Benchmarking An International Journal, IEEE Transactions on Engineering Management and Materials Science and Engineering A.
